pkgsrc-Changes arch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
CVS commit: pkgsrc/devel/kdiff3
Module Name: pkgsrc
Committed By: wiz
Date: Fri Feb 7 09:24:31 UTC 2025
Modified Files:
pkgsrc/devel/kdiff3: Makefile PLIST distinfo
Log Message:
kdiff3: update to 1.12.0.
Version 1.12.0 - 2024
=========================
*Completed port away from Qt5, 6.6 now required version due to delayed ICU support in Qt
*Fixed UTF-8-BOM output encoding issues mustly seen on windows.
*horizontal scroll correctly comptuted for diff windows
--Note due to changes in windows/Qt the scrollbars may be vary small or hidden on Windows 11. This cann't be controlled from kdiff3.
*False errors on first launch with files selected should be fixed.
Version 1.11.x - 2024
===========================
*Fix false memory error when using "admin://" protocol
*Cleanup BOM handling lock detection to only known UTF-* encodings that use it.
*Fix bugged connection to non-existent signal (This is why we now use new style connections only.)
*fix crash in Diff3Line::getLineData when doing history check for nonexistent lines.
*fix crash on some setups that create 0 height widgets when no data is loaded.
*Fixed encoding handling for non-UTF encodings
*Fixed encoding detection for lower case 'HTML' and 'XML' tags
*Fix handling of KIO jobs for non-file urls.
-Actually wait for secondary event loop to end (Not sure if this is documention bug in qt or behavior bug.)
-Don't arbitrarily kill jobs when progress dialog is hidden.
*Fix possible invalid line given by mousedown in Overview pane. (Caught by SafeInt range checking)
*Fix bad algorithm in getBestFirstLine.
-Related regression also fixed (BUG:486909)
*craft based builds are now Qt6/kf6.
To generate a diff of this commit:
cvs rdiff -u -r1.113 -r1.114 pkgsrc/devel/kdiff3/Makefile
cvs rdiff -u -r1.13 -r1.14 pkgsrc/devel/kdiff3/PLIST
cvs rdiff -u -r1.24 -r1.25 pkgsrc/devel/kdiff3/distinfo
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.
Modified files:
Index: pkgsrc/devel/kdiff3/Makefile
diff -u pkgsrc/devel/kdiff3/Makefile:1.113 pkgsrc/devel/kdiff3/Makefile:1.114
--- pkgsrc/devel/kdiff3/Makefile:1.113 Thu Jan 23 23:27:25 2025
+++ pkgsrc/devel/kdiff3/Makefile Fri Feb 7 09:24:31 2025
@@ -1,7 +1,6 @@
-# $NetBSD: Makefile,v 1.113 2025/01/23 23:27:25 riastradh Exp $
+# $NetBSD: Makefile,v 1.114 2025/02/07 09:24:31 wiz Exp $
-DISTNAME= kdiff3-1.10.7
-PKGREVISION= 7
+DISTNAME= kdiff3-1.12.0
CATEGORIES= devel
MASTER_SITES= ${MASTER_SITE_KDE:=kdiff3/}
EXTRACT_SUFX= .tar.xz
@@ -11,31 +10,26 @@ HOMEPAGE= https://kde.org/applications/d
COMMENT= File and directory diff and merge tool
LICENSE= gnu-gpl-v2
-USE_CMAKE= yes
-USE_LANGUAGES= c c++
-
-# Upstream states GCC < 8.2 support is "best effort only"; it is presently
-# confirmed to work without issue on NetBSD 9.x with GCC 7.5.
+USE_LANGUAGES= c c++
+# upstream states GCC < 9.2 support is "best effort only"
USE_CXX_FEATURES+= c++17
+CMAKE_REQD+= 3.1
BUILDLINK_TRANSFORM+= rm:-Wl,--fatal-warnings
-TOOLS_DEPENDS.cmake= cmake>=3.1:../../devel/cmake
-
+.include "../../devel/cmake/build.mk"
.include "../../devel/boost-headers/buildlink3.mk"
-BUILDLINK_API_DEPENDS.extra-cmake-modules+= extra-cmake-modules>=5.10.0
+.include "../../devel/boost-libs/buildlink3.mk"
.include "../../devel/extra-cmake-modules/buildlink3.mk"
.include "../../devel/gettext-lib/buildlink3.mk"
-BUILDLINK_API_DEPENDS.kcoreaddons+= kcoreaddons>=5.80.0
-.include "../../devel/kcoreaddons/buildlink3.mk"
-.include "../../devel/kcrash/buildlink3.mk"
-.include "../../devel/kdoctools/buildlink3.mk"
-BUILDLINK_API_DEPENDS.ki18n+= ki18n>=5.80.0
-.include "../../devel/ki18n/buildlink3.mk"
-.include "../../devel/kio/buildlink3.mk"
-.include "../../devel/kparts/buildlink3.mk"
+.include "../../devel/kf6-kconfig/buildlink3.mk"
+.include "../../devel/kf6-kcoreaddons/buildlink3.mk"
+.include "../../devel/kf6-kcrash/buildlink3.mk"
+.include "../../devel/kf6-ki18n/buildlink3.mk"
+.include "../../devel/kf6-kio/buildlink3.mk"
+.include "../../devel/qt6-qt5compat/buildlink3.mk"
.include "../../graphics/hicolor-icon-theme/buildlink3.mk"
-.include "../../graphics/kiconthemes/buildlink3.mk"
-.include "../../x11/kwidgetsaddons/buildlink3.mk"
-.include "../../x11/qt5-qtbase/buildlink3.mk"
+.include "../../x11/kf6-kwidgetsaddons/buildlink3.mk"
+.include "../../x11/kf6-kxmlgui/buildlink3.mk"
+.include "../../x11/qt6-qtbase/buildlink3.mk"
.include "../../mk/bsd.pkg.mk"
Index: pkgsrc/devel/kdiff3/PLIST
diff -u pkgsrc/devel/kdiff3/PLIST:1.13 pkgsrc/devel/kdiff3/PLIST:1.14
--- pkgsrc/devel/kdiff3/PLIST:1.13 Thu Dec 14 22:47:05 2023
+++ pkgsrc/devel/kdiff3/PLIST Fri Feb 7 09:24:31 2025
@@ -1,13 +1,13 @@
-@comment $NetBSD: PLIST,v 1.13 2023/12/14 22:47:05 gutteridge Exp $
+@comment $NetBSD: PLIST,v 1.14 2025/02/07 09:24:31 wiz Exp $
bin/kdiff3
-lib/plugins/kf5/kfileitemaction/kdiff3fileitemaction.so
-lib/plugins/kf5/parts/kdiff3part.so
+lib/plugins/kf6/kfileitemaction/kdiff3fileitemaction.so
man/ca/man1/kdiff3.1
man/de/man1/kdiff3.1
man/es/man1/kdiff3.1
man/it/man1/kdiff3.1
man/man1/kdiff3.1
man/nl/man1/kdiff3.1
+man/sl/man1/kdiff3.1
man/sv/man1/kdiff3.1
man/uk/man1/kdiff3.1
share/applications/org.kde.kdiff3.desktop
@@ -35,6 +35,10 @@ share/doc/HTML/it/kdiff3/index.cache.bz2
share/doc/HTML/it/kdiff3/index.docbook
share/doc/HTML/nl/kdiff3/index.cache.bz2
share/doc/HTML/nl/kdiff3/index.docbook
+share/doc/HTML/pt/kdiff3/index.cache.bz2
+share/doc/HTML/pt/kdiff3/index.docbook
+share/doc/HTML/sl/kdiff3/index.cache.bz2
+share/doc/HTML/sl/kdiff3/index.docbook
share/doc/HTML/sv/kdiff3/index.cache.bz2
share/doc/HTML/sv/kdiff3/index.docbook
share/doc/HTML/uk/kdiff3/index.cache.bz2
@@ -47,10 +51,10 @@ share/icons/hicolor/32x32/apps/kdiff3.pn
share/icons/hicolor/48x48/apps/kdiff3.png
share/icons/hicolor/64x64/apps/kdiff3.png
share/icons/hicolor/scalable/apps/kdiff3.svgz
-share/kservices5/kdiff3part.desktop
-share/kxmlgui5/kdiff3/kdiff3_shell.rc
-share/kxmlgui5/kdiff3part/kdiff3_part.rc
share/locale/ar/LC_MESSAGES/kdiff3.mo
+share/locale/ast/LC_MESSAGES/diff_ext.mo
+share/locale/ast/LC_MESSAGES/kdiff3.mo
+share/locale/ast/LC_MESSAGES/kdiff3fileitemactionplugin.mo
share/locale/bg/LC_MESSAGES/diff_ext.mo
share/locale/bg/LC_MESSAGES/kdiff3.mo
share/locale/bg/LC_MESSAGES/kdiff3fileitemactionplugin.mo
@@ -101,6 +105,9 @@ share/locale/ga/LC_MESSAGES/kdiff3fileit
share/locale/gl/LC_MESSAGES/diff_ext.mo
share/locale/gl/LC_MESSAGES/kdiff3.mo
share/locale/gl/LC_MESSAGES/kdiff3fileitemactionplugin.mo
+share/locale/he/LC_MESSAGES/diff_ext.mo
+share/locale/he/LC_MESSAGES/kdiff3.mo
+share/locale/he/LC_MESSAGES/kdiff3fileitemactionplugin.mo
share/locale/hi/LC_MESSAGES/kdiff3.mo
share/locale/hne/LC_MESSAGES/kdiff3.mo
share/locale/hr/LC_MESSAGES/kdiff3.mo
@@ -125,6 +132,7 @@ share/locale/ka/LC_MESSAGES/kdiff3fileit
share/locale/ko/LC_MESSAGES/diff_ext.mo
share/locale/ko/LC_MESSAGES/kdiff3.mo
share/locale/ko/LC_MESSAGES/kdiff3fileitemactionplugin.mo
+share/locale/lt/LC_MESSAGES/diff_ext.mo
share/locale/lt/LC_MESSAGES/kdiff3.mo
share/locale/lt/LC_MESSAGES/kdiff3fileitemactionplugin.mo
share/locale/mai/LC_MESSAGES/kdiff3.mo
Index: pkgsrc/devel/kdiff3/distinfo
diff -u pkgsrc/devel/kdiff3/distinfo:1.24 pkgsrc/devel/kdiff3/distinfo:1.25
--- pkgsrc/devel/kdiff3/distinfo:1.24 Thu Dec 14 22:47:05 2023
+++ pkgsrc/devel/kdiff3/distinfo Fri Feb 7 09:24:31 2025
@@ -1,5 +1,5 @@
-$NetBSD: distinfo,v 1.24 2023/12/14 22:47:05 gutteridge Exp $
+$NetBSD: distinfo,v 1.25 2025/02/07 09:24:31 wiz Exp $
-BLAKE2s (kdiff3-1.10.7.tar.xz) = 88de36f58c21cf25d15a7637cd7c4629eb3093da435c42dc9a11a5bf174c4ee4
-SHA512 (kdiff3-1.10.7.tar.xz) = ab7ce8312014de200bcc613be1a28b384289f96be08d7f2e1e640b202cede3bbfeffa7b3e53b605f8edf9be2368d2aa6c6b5ee4501577ed8560ca1c4704802db
-Size (kdiff3-1.10.7.tar.xz) = 1131116 bytes
+BLAKE2s (kdiff3-1.12.0.tar.xz) = 8039e23394f68e42ca8925d32f2eaee8d066c635490005cb3f8a27987225bf76
+SHA512 (kdiff3-1.12.0.tar.xz) = d409f3be076ee2a4a736c201fe7b509304b29a843490b6e60b5f2e221dc34c5d78ba717e08c4ce053f9af28c6750c600658a84853e0ed5591161320e3bcef631
+Size (kdiff3-1.12.0.tar.xz) = 1204256 bytes
Home |
Main Index |
Thread Index |
Old Index